Re: Week 4 TNF: Baltimore Ravens (0-3) @ Pittsburgh Steelers (2-1)
Honestly, think it's a pretty solid fit for Vick. Bell is back and Williams ran well, so a focus on the run game seems smart. Then you remember you have Antonio Brown, so that's a top weapon in the league. Okay, not bad. But even DHB can run under some long Vick throws and Miller can be the safety valve. Wheaton is still suiting up there too.
The OL should be used to some scrambling around with Ben not being a statue back there, though no QB can prepare you (defensively or offensively) for the amount that Vick tends to do. The only thing holding me back from making the Steelers a lock is that Baltimore is in one of those early season must-win scenarios. Thought that same thing last week against Cincy and it didn't seem to matter, though. But the Steelers/Ravens rivalry is quite real, and expecting something in this feud usually blows up in your face. If you would've asked me which teams would be facing which scenarios, I'd have had these two in opposite positions. We've learned a lot about both clubs in just 3 weeks. The Ravens just don't seem to have it this year, so I've gotta give the nod to Pittsburgh. It won't be without some drama, as these games are brutal. Seeing PIT 19, BAL 12. |
